Australian Dollar Gains After RBA Holds Rates Steady

The Australian dollar strengthened against other major currencies after the Reserve Bank of Australia (RBA) announced it would hold the benchmark interest rate steady at its current level. The decision reflects the RBA’s assessment of the current economic climate and its outlook for future growth.

Key Factors Influencing the RBA’s Decision

Several factors contributed to the RBA’s decision to maintain the status quo:

  • Stable Economic Growth: The RBA noted that the Australian economy has demonstrated relative stability in recent months.
  • Inflation Targets: Current inflation levels are within the RBA’s target range.
  • Global Economic Conditions: The RBA is closely monitoring global economic developments and their potential impact on the Australian economy.

Market Reaction

The market reacted positively to the RBA’s announcement, with the Australian dollar experiencing a notable increase in value. Investors are interpreting the RBA’s decision as a sign of confidence in the Australian economy.

Future Outlook

The RBA has indicated that it will continue to monitor economic data closely and adjust monetary policy as needed. Market participants will be paying close attention to upcoming economic releases, including inflation figures, employment data, and GDP growth, for clues about the RBA’s future policy intentions.
